The ballroom gleamed with a cold, clinical beauty, all crystal chandeliers and polished marble floors. Waiters in pristine uniforms moved like clockwork, balancing trays of champagne flutes. The attendees, dressed in gowns and tuxedos that screamed wealth, clustered in small groups, their conversations laced with laughter that never quite reached their eyes.
Adrian Blackwell stood at the edge of it all, his sharp gaze sweeping over the room like a predator surveying its territory. He hated these events, despised the hollow rituals of networking and superficial charm. But tonight, he had no choice. His company, Blackwell Industries, was under siege, and appearances mattered. The board needed reassurance that their CEO was untouchable, that he could weather any storm-even one as personal as this.
He adjusted the cuffs of his tailored tuxedo, the motion smooth and deliberate. Everything about Adrian exuded control, from the precision of his movements to the way his dark hair was slicked back. Control was his armor, a necessary shield in the world of billionaires and sharks.
"Mr. Blackwell," a voice interrupted his thoughts. Adrian turned, offering a tight smile to a middle-aged man whose handshake was as limp as his conversation. The man droned on about a potential merger, but Adrian's attention drifted, his focus narrowing to a woman across the room.
She stood near one of the massive arched windows, her figure illuminated by the soft glow of the city lights outside. Her dress was simple yet elegant, a deep burgundy that complemented her sun-kissed skin. Dark curls framed her face, and her lips curved into a smile as she spoke with an elderly couple. There was something magnetic about her, something real amidst the sea of artificiality.
Adrian excused himself from the conversation without a second thought, his steps carrying him toward her before he fully understood why.
Elena Marquez felt out of place, but she refused to show it. This was not her world-not the glitzy gala, not the towering skyscrapers visible through the floor-to-ceiling windows. Her world was a small, struggling art gallery on the edge of town, where passion mattered more than profit and every sale felt like a lifeline. But tonight, she was here on behalf of her late father's foundation, tasked with mingling among the wealthy elite to secure funding for their next project.
Her patience was wearing thin. She'd endured patronizing comments and thinly veiled insults disguised as pleasantries. Still, she kept her head high and her tone polite, even when a man in a diamond-studded cufflinks had suggested she sell her gallery to "someone more competent."
"Excuse me," Elena said now, her smile tight as she stepped away from yet another insufferable conversation. She found refuge near the windows, letting the cool glass soothe her nerves.
"You seem to be having as much fun as I am," a deep voice said behind her.
She turned, startled, and found herself face-to-face with a man who radiated authority. His sharp jawline, piercing gray eyes, and impeccably tailored tuxedo screamed wealth and power. But there was something else in his expression-curiosity, perhaps, or amusement.
"Is it that obvious?" Elena replied, raising an eyebrow.
"A little," he admitted, the corner of his mouth twitching in what might have been a smile.
She studied him, noting the way he held himself with a confidence that bordered on arrogance. He was handsome in a way that felt almost unfair, but his presence set her on edge.
"And you are?" she prompted, her tone cool.
"Adrian Blackwell," he said, offering his hand.
Recognition flickered in her eyes. Adrian Blackwell was a name she knew, a name anyone with even a passing knowledge of the business world would know. Billionaire tech mogul. Ruthless CEO. The man who had single-handedly revolutionized an industry and crushed anyone who stood in his way.
"I see," she said, shaking his hand. "And what brings the great Adrian Blackwell to grace us mere mortals tonight?"
Her words were laced with sarcasm, and Adrian's smile widened. He wasn't used to being addressed with anything less than reverence or fear.
"Business," he said simply. "And you?"
"Also business," Elena replied. She debated ending the conversation there, but something about Adrian's gaze held her. "I'm here on behalf of the Marquez Foundation. We're trying to secure funding for an arts program in underserved communities."
"Admirable," Adrian said, though his tone was neutral.
"Admirable but not profitable," she said, her lips curving into a wry smile.
"Not everything has to be about profit," Adrian said, surprising even himself with the admission.
Elena's eyes narrowed. "Is that so? I thought people like you didn't believe in altruism unless there was a tax break involved."
Adrian chuckled, a low sound that sent a shiver down her spine. "People like me? You make it sound as if I'm a different species."
"Aren't you?" she shot back, her voice playful but edged with challenge.
Adrian's smile faded slightly, replaced by something more serious. "Maybe I am," he said softly. "But that doesn't mean I don't recognize the value in what you're doing."
Elena blinked, caught off guard by his sincerity. She had expected arrogance, perhaps a dismissal, but not this.
Before she could respond, a voice interrupted them. "Adrian! There you are!"
A tall, slender woman approached, her gown shimmering like liquid gold. She placed a hand on Adrian's arm, her red lips curving into a smile that didn't reach her eyes.
"Vanessa," Adrian said, his tone polite but distant.
"I've been looking for you all evening," she said, ignoring Elena entirely. "We need to discuss the upcoming board meeting."
Adrian turned back to Elena, his expression apologetic. "Excuse me for a moment."
"Of course," Elena said, stepping back.
She watched as Adrian and Vanessa moved across the room, their conversation low and intense. Something about the interaction left a sour taste in her mouth. Shaking her head, she turned away and headed for the exit.
This was not her world, and she had no intention of pretending otherwise.
Adrian, meanwhile, found his attention drifting as Vanessa spoke. His gaze flicked toward the windows, where Elena had been standing moments ago. She was gone.
For the first time in years, he felt a flicker of something unfamiliar.
Curiosity... And perhaps, just perhaps, regret.
